We understand that after updating your Apple Watch, it continues to unlock. This behavior could be related to the software. In that case, we'd like to provide you with a few steps that can often resolve software-related issues:
- Restart Apple Watch. This allows for your device and the software to be refreshed.
- Unpair and erase your Apple Watch. Unpairing your Apple Watch restores it to its factory settings.
("Before erasing all content and settings on your Apple Watch, your iPhone creates a new backup of your Apple Watch. You can use the backup to restore a new Apple Watch. After your Apple Watch unpairs, you'll see the Start Pairing message")
